Pavers Installation in Norwalk, CT
Pavers installation services involve the process of laying durable, attractive paving materials to enhance outdoor spaces such as driveways, walkways, patios, and courtyards. This service covers a variety of project types, including creating new paved surfaces, replacing aging or damaged paving, or expanding existing areas. Property owners typically want to understand the different types of pavers available, such as concrete, brick, or stone, as well as the benefits of each. Additionally, considerations like design options, drainage, and the overall durability of the materials are important factors when planning a pavers project.
Before requesting pavers installation, homeowners should consider the scope of their project, including the size and layout of the area to be paved. It’s helpful to think about the desired aesthetic, the level of foot or vehicle traffic the surface will endure, and any specific functional needs, such as slip resistance or easy maintenance. Understanding the foundation requirements and potential costs involved can also assist in making informed decisions. Contacting a professional can provide guidance on material choices, design ideas, and the necessary preparations for a successful installation.

Pavers Installation Questions
What types of surfaces can be paved? Pavers can be installed on driveways, walkways, patios, and outdoor living areas to enhance durability and appearance.
Are pavers su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, pavers are designed to withstand heavy foot and vehicle traffic, making them ideal for busy outdoor spaces.
What materials are commonly used for pavers?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different aesthetic and performance qualities.
How do pavers improve property value? Paved surfaces add curb appeal and functionality, which can enhance the overall value of a property.
